We're doing a TPM2_CC_CREATE, but as part of a "seal" operation for some data, rather than full asymmetric key creation. So I don't think this is likely to be the cause, but it's given me the idea to see if we are seeing a spike on a particular command - maybe there's something that's close to the edge on timings that is occasionally going over. Playing around with bpftrace seems to give useful data so I'll need to investigate if I can deploy that to do some monitoring. Our monitoring is running hourly and does the following TPM2 operations (including the in kernel context switching): TPM2_CC_SELF_TEST TPM2_CC_GET_CAPABILITY TPM2_CC_READ_PUBLIC TPM2_CC_READ_PUBLIC TPM2_CC_CREATE TPM2_CC_LOAD TPM2_CC_CONTEXT_SAVE TPM2_CC_FLUSH_CONTEXT TPM2_CC_CONTEXT_LOAD TPM2_CC_UNSEAL TPM2_CC_CONTEXT_SAVE TPM2_CC_FLUSH_CONTEXT TPM2_CC_CONTEXT_LOAD TPM2_CC_FLUSH_CONTEXT TPM2_CC_CONTEXT_SAVE TPM2_CC_READ_CLOCK TPM2_CC_GET_CAPABILITY TPM2_CC_GET_CAPABILITY TPM2_CC_GET_CAPABILITY TPM2_CC_GET_CAPABILITY TPM2_CC_GET_CAPABILITY TPM2_CC_GET_CAPABILITY TPM2_CC_READ_PUBLIC J. -- If I, um, err.
